public static final class ListControlsResponse.Builder extends com.google.protobuf.GeneratedMessageV3.Builder<ListControlsResponse.Builder> implements ListControlsResponseOrBuilder
Response for ListControls method.Protobuf type
google.cloud.retail.v2.ListControlsResponse| Modifier and Type | Method and Description |
|---|---|
ListControlsResponse.Builder |
addAllControls(Iterable<? extends Control> values)
All the Controls for a given catalog.
|
ListControlsResponse.Builder |
addControls(Control.Builder builderForValue)
All the Controls for a given catalog.
|
ListControlsResponse.Builder |
addControls(Control value)
All the Controls for a given catalog.
|
ListControlsResponse.Builder |
addControls(int index,
Control.Builder builderForValue)
All the Controls for a given catalog.
|
ListControlsResponse.Builder |
addControls(int index,
Control value)
All the Controls for a given catalog.
|
Control.Builder |
addControlsBuilder()
All the Controls for a given catalog.
|
Control.Builder |
addControlsBuilder(int index)
All the Controls for a given catalog.
|
ListControlsResponse.Builder |
addRepeatedField(com.google.protobuf.Descriptors.FieldDescriptor field,
Object value) |
ListControlsResponse |
build() |
ListControlsResponse |
buildPartial() |
ListControlsResponse.Builder |
clear() |
ListControlsResponse.Builder |
clearControls()
All the Controls for a given catalog.
|
ListControlsResponse.Builder |
clearField(com.google.protobuf.Descriptors.FieldDescriptor field) |
ListControlsResponse.Builder |
clearNextPageToken()
Pagination token, if not returned indicates the last page.
|
ListControlsResponse.Builder |
clearOneof(com.google.protobuf.Descriptors.OneofDescriptor oneof) |
ListControlsResponse.Builder |
clone() |
Control |
getControls(int index)
All the Controls for a given catalog.
|
Control.Builder |
getControlsBuilder(int index)
All the Controls for a given catalog.
|
List<Control.Builder> |
getControlsBuilderList()
All the Controls for a given catalog.
|
int |
getControlsCount()
All the Controls for a given catalog.
|
List<Control> |
getControlsList()
All the Controls for a given catalog.
|
ControlOrBuilder |
getControlsOrBuilder(int index)
All the Controls for a given catalog.
|
List<? extends ControlOrBuilder> |
getControlsOrBuilderList()
All the Controls for a given catalog.
|
ListControlsResponse |
getDefaultInstanceForType() |
static com.google.protobuf.Descriptors.Descriptor |
getDescriptor() |
com.google.protobuf.Descriptors.Descriptor |
getDescriptorForType() |
String |
getNextPageToken()
Pagination token, if not returned indicates the last page.
|
com.google.protobuf.ByteString |
getNextPageTokenBytes()
Pagination token, if not returned indicates the last page.
|
protected com.google.protobuf.GeneratedMessageV3.FieldAccessorTable |
internalGetFieldAccessorTable() |
boolean |
isInitialized() |
ListControlsResponse.Builder |
mergeFrom(com.google.protobuf.CodedInputStream input,
com.google.protobuf.ExtensionRegistryLite extensionRegistry) |
ListControlsResponse.Builder |
mergeFrom(ListControlsResponse other) |
ListControlsResponse.Builder |
mergeFrom(com.google.protobuf.Message other) |
ListControlsResponse.Builder |
mergeUnknownFields(com.google.protobuf.UnknownFieldSet unknownFields) |
ListControlsResponse.Builder |
removeControls(int index)
All the Controls for a given catalog.
|
ListControlsResponse.Builder |
setControls(int index,
Control.Builder builderForValue)
All the Controls for a given catalog.
|
ListControlsResponse.Builder |
setControls(int index,
Control value)
All the Controls for a given catalog.
|
ListControlsResponse.Builder |
setField(com.google.protobuf.Descriptors.FieldDescriptor field,
Object value) |
ListControlsResponse.Builder |
setNextPageToken(String value)
Pagination token, if not returned indicates the last page.
|
ListControlsResponse.Builder |
setNextPageTokenBytes(com.google.protobuf.ByteString value)
Pagination token, if not returned indicates the last page.
|
ListControlsResponse.Builder |
setRepeatedField(com.google.protobuf.Descriptors.FieldDescriptor field,
int index,
Object value) |
ListControlsResponse.Builder |
setUnknownFields(com.google.protobuf.UnknownFieldSet unknownFields) |
getAllFields, getField, getFieldBuilder, getOneofFieldDescriptor, getParentForChildren, getRepeatedField, getRepeatedFieldBuilder, getRepeatedFieldCount, getUnknownFields, getUnknownFieldSetBuilder, hasField, hasOneof, internalGetMapField, internalGetMapFieldReflection, internalGetMutableMapField, internalGetMutableMapFieldReflection, isClean, markClean, mergeUnknownLengthDelimitedField, mergeUnknownVarintField, newBuilderForField, onBuilt, onChanged, parseUnknownField, setUnknownFieldSetBuilder, setUnknownFieldsProto3findInitializationErrors, getInitializationErrorString, internalMerg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, newUninitializedMessageException, toStringaddAll, addAll, mergeDelimitedFrom, mergeDelimitedFrom, newUninitializedMessageExceptionequals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, waitpublic static final com.google.protobuf.Descriptors.Descriptor getDescriptor()
protected com.google.protobuf.G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
internalGetFieldAccessorTable in class com.google.protobuf.GeneratedMessageV3.Builder<ListControlsResponse.Builder>public ListControlsResponse.Builder clear()
clear in interface com.google.protobuf.Message.Builderclear in interface com.google.protobuf.MessageLite.Builderclear in class com.google.protobuf.GeneratedMessageV3.Builder<ListControlsResponse.Builder>public com.google.protobuf.Descriptors.Descriptor getDescriptorForType()
getDescriptorForType in interface com.google.protobuf.Message.BuildergetDescriptorForType in interface com.google.protobuf.MessageOrBuildergetDescriptorForType in class com.google.protobuf.GeneratedMessageV3.Builder<ListControlsResponse.Builder>public ListControlsResponse getDefaultInstanceForType()
getDefaultInstanceForType in interface com.google.protobuf.MessageLiteOrBuildergetDefaultInstanceForType in interface com.google.protobuf.MessageOrBuilderpublic ListControlsResponse build()
build in interface com.google.protobuf.Message.Builderbuild in interface com.google.protobuf.MessageLite.Builderpublic ListControlsResponse buildPartial()
buildPartial in interface com.google.protobuf.Message.BuilderbuildPartial in interface com.google.protobuf.MessageLite.Builderpublic ListControlsResponse.Builder clone()
clone in interface com.google.protobuf.Message.Builderclone in interface com.google.protobuf.MessageLite.Builderclone in class com.google.protobuf.GeneratedMessageV3.Builder<ListControlsResponse.Builder>public ListControlsResponse.Builder setField(com.google.protobuf.Descriptors.FieldDescriptor field, Object value)
setField in interface com.google.protobuf.Message.BuildersetField in class com.google.protobuf.GeneratedMessageV3.Builder<ListControlsResponse.Builder>public ListControlsResponse.Builder clearField(com.google.protobuf.Descriptors.FieldDescriptor field)
clearField in interface com.google.protobuf.Message.BuilderclearField in class com.google.protobuf.GeneratedMessageV3.Builder<ListControlsResponse.Builder>public ListControlsResponse.Builder clearOneof(com.google.protobuf.Descriptors.OneofDescriptor oneof)
clearOneof in interface com.google.protobuf.Message.BuilderclearOneof in class com.google.protobuf.GeneratedMessageV3.Builder<ListControlsResponse.Builder>public ListControlsResponse.Builder setRepeatedField(com.google.protobuf.Descriptors.FieldDescriptor field, int index, Object value)
setRepeatedField in interface com.google.protobuf.Message.BuildersetRepeatedField in class com.google.protobuf.GeneratedMessageV3.Builder<ListControlsResponse.Builder>public ListControlsResponse.Builder addRepeatedField(com.google.protobuf.Descriptors.FieldDescriptor field, Object value)
addRepeatedField in interface com.google.protobuf.Message.BuilderaddRepeatedField in class com.google.protobuf.GeneratedMessageV3.Builder<ListControlsResponse.Builder>public ListControlsResponse.Builder mergeFrom(com.google.protobuf.Message other)
mergeFrom in interface com.google.protobuf.Message.BuildermergeFrom in class com.google.protobuf.AbstractMessage.Builder<ListControlsResponse.Builder>public ListControlsResponse.Builder mergeFrom(ListControlsResponse other)
public final boolean isInitialized()
isInitialized in interface com.google.protobuf.MessageLiteOrBuilderisInitialized in class com.google.protobuf.GeneratedMessageV3.Builder<ListControlsResponse.Builder>public ListControlsResponse.Builder mergeFrom(com.google.protobuf.CodedInput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ws IOException
mergeFrom in interface com.google.protobuf.Message.BuildermergeFrom in interface com.google.protobuf.MessageLite.BuildermergeFrom in class com.google.protobuf.AbstractMessage.Builder<ListControlsResponse.Builder>IOExceptionpublic List<Control> getControlsList()
All the Controls for a given catalog.
repeated .google.cloud.retail.v2.Control controls = 1;getControlsList in interface ListControlsResponseOrBuilderpublic int getControlsCount()
All the Controls for a given catalog.
repeated .google.cloud.retail.v2.Control controls = 1;getControlsCount in interface ListControlsResponseOrBuilderpublic Control getControls(int index)
All the Controls for a given catalog.
repeated .google.cloud.retail.v2.Control controls = 1;getControls in interface ListControlsResponseOrBuilderpublic ListControlsResponse.Builder setControls(int index, Control value)
All the Controls for a given catalog.
repeated .google.cloud.retail.v2.Control controls = 1;public ListControlsResponse.Builder setControls(int index, Control.Builder builderForValue)
All the Controls for a given catalog.
repeated .google.cloud.retail.v2.Control controls = 1;public ListControlsResponse.Builder addControls(Control value)
All the Controls for a given catalog.
repeated .google.cloud.retail.v2.Control controls = 1;public ListControlsResponse.Builder addControls(int index, Control value)
All the Controls for a given catalog.
repeated .google.cloud.retail.v2.Control controls = 1;public ListControlsResponse.Builder addControls(Control.Builder builderForValue)
All the Controls for a given catalog.
repeated .google.cloud.retail.v2.Control controls = 1;public ListControlsResponse.Builder addControls(int index, Control.Builder builderForValue)
All the Controls for a given catalog.
repeated .google.cloud.retail.v2.Control controls = 1;public ListControlsResponse.Builder addAllControls(Iterable<? extends Control> values)
All the Controls for a given catalog.
repeated .google.cloud.retail.v2.Control controls = 1;public ListControlsResponse.Builder clearControls()
All the Controls for a given catalog.
repeated .google.cloud.retail.v2.Control controls = 1;public ListControlsResponse.Builder removeControls(int index)
All the Controls for a given catalog.
repeated .google.cloud.retail.v2.Control controls = 1;public Control.Builder getControlsBuilder(int index)
All the Controls for a given catalog.
repeated .google.cloud.retail.v2.Control controls = 1;public ControlOrBuilder getControlsOrBuilder(int index)
All the Controls for a given catalog.
repeated .google.cloud.retail.v2.Control controls = 1;getControlsOrBuilder in interface ListControlsResponseOrBuilderpublic List<? extends ControlOrBuilder> getControlsOrBuilderList()
All the Controls for a given catalog.
repeated .google.cloud.retail.v2.Control controls = 1;getControlsOrBuilderList in interface ListControlsResponseOrBuilderpublic Control.Builder addControlsBuilder()
All the Controls for a given catalog.
repeated .google.cloud.retail.v2.Control controls = 1;public Control.Builder addControlsBuilder(int index)
All the Controls for a given catalog.
repeated .google.cloud.retail.v2.Control controls = 1;public List<Control.Builder> getControlsBuilderList()
All the Controls for a given catalog.
repeated .google.cloud.retail.v2.Control controls = 1;public String getNextPageToken()
Pagination token, if not returned indicates the last page.
string next_page_token = 2;getNextPageToken in interface ListControlsResponseOrBuilderpublic com.google.protobuf.ByteString getNextPageTokenBytes()
Pagination token, if not returned indicates the last page.
string next_page_token = 2;getNextPageTokenBytes in interface ListControlsResponseOrBuilderpublic ListControlsResponse.Builder setNextPageToken(String value)
Pagination token, if not returned indicates the last page.
string next_page_token = 2;value - The nextPageToken to set.public ListControlsResponse.Builder clearNextPageToken()
Pagination token, if not returned indicates the last page.
string next_page_token = 2;public ListControlsResponse.Builder setNextPageTokenBytes(com.google.protobuf.ByteString value)
Pagination token, if not returned indicates the last page.
string next_page_token = 2;value - The bytes for nextPageToken to set.public final ListControlsResponse.Builder setUnknownFields(com.google.protobuf.UnknownFieldSet unknownFields)
setUnknownFields in interface com.google.protobuf.Message.BuildersetUnknownFields in class com.google.protobuf.GeneratedMessageV3.Builder<ListControlsResponse.Builder>public final ListControlsResponse.Builder mergeUnknownFields(com.google.protobuf.UnknownFieldSet unknownFields)
mergeUnknownFields in interface com.google.protobuf.Message.BuildermergeUnknownFields in class com.google.protobuf.GeneratedMessageV3.Builder<ListControlsResponse.Builder>Copyright © 2023 Google LLC. All rights reserved.